Previous car was chitbox 93 9C1 that blew a head gasket. Found this 96 B4U for a few hundred dollars more than what it was going to cost to fix the 9C1, and had full leather/power. It was originally Marblehead Metallic with grey interior.

The guy I bought it from had already deleted the antenna, trunk key, wheel moldings, and hood ornament. I picked up new-in-box fiberglass smoothie bumpers cheap off craigslist, and used a homie hookup over at a paint shop to get bumpers on and car sprayed. Before paint:



The rear wheels are also a craigslist score - N97's stretched to 10" that were used with slicks at the track, but the guy wrecked his Impala and sold the wheels to me. I had the whole set painted and put BFG 245/60's up front and 295/50's out back. I get the most compliments and questions about the wheels



I've been repairing/replacing/modifying/customizing as needed, becomes available, or can afford it. I scored another craigslist find on a lot including the headers, Holley TB, tuned PCM, F-body MAF & aluminum radiator for $500. Changed up my engine bay quite a bit with that one buy



The interior is showing it's age, but will get a complete makeover in 2015. I'll be going all out on that. Also what lowering springs did the owner use?? It's got a sweet sleek stance!

Monroe SS shocks all around, Moog 5662 front/stock Imp SS rear springs, Airlift helper bags

Interior items going in

So here's the stash of interior items that I've been collecting, that are going in this month:




  • Replacing dash pad and adding cover
  • Replace lower dash and repaint
  • 96 Impala steering column
  • z28 cluster
  • Monte Carlo wheel
  • Roadmaster HVAC conversion
  • Oldsmobile LSS center console/floor shifter
  • Olds LSS seats (to be reworked)
  • Blazer overhead console
  • New carpet
  • New headliner
  • Replace door panels
